Customers are saying

Customers frequently mention the Lightning-to-3.5mm Headphone Adapter's compatibility, quality, and ease of use as positive features. The adapter's size and reliable connection are also appreciated. Some customers express missing the convenience of a dedicated headphone jack and the ability to charge while listening, while others find the design to be less robust.

    For those that want to continue using wired headphones/earbuds on newer iPhones that do not have the 3.5mm headphone jack, this adapter works great. I have a high quality wired earbuds that still work, and I still wanted to use them on a newer iPhone just purchased. Only drawback is not able to charge the phone at the same time. Apple makes another adapter that has a splitter to be able to charge the phone and plug in a headphone/earbuds at the same time, but costs more than twice the amount of this one.

    Some of the newer iPhones etc. have eliminated the headphone jack. In those cases, this adapter is required to use standard headphones. While my iPad has a headphone jack, the cover / case I use makes connection difficult. This adapter is a handy way to fix the problem. At about $10, the price is reasonable. Since it is genuine Apple, there is no concern about quality or compatibility.
